在网站制作中,数据库设计和数据存储优化是至关要紧的一步。一个合理设计的数据库结构不只能提升网站的性能和稳定性,还能为后续的数据操作提供便利。本文将从数据库设计和数据存储两个方面详细介绍在网站制作中怎么样优化数据库的用法。1. 数据库设计 数据库设计是网站制作中最基础也是最重要的一环。在设计数据库时,需要充分考虑网站的业务需要和数据特征。以下是一些数据库设计的需要注意的地方:合理划分数据表:将数据根据逻辑关系划分为多个数据表,每一个表负责保存特定种类的数据。表之间要维持明确的关系,如有需要可用外键打造关联。选择合适的数据种类:依据数据的性质和大小,选择适合的数据种类。防止用过长或过短的数据种类,以免浪费存储空间或导致数据截断。设置索引:对常常被查看或筛选的字段打造索引,可以大幅度提升查看效率。但过多的索引也会增加数据库的负担,需要权衡利弊进行设置。规范命名:为数据表、字段、索引等对象命名时应规范统一,以便于管理和维护数据库。2. 数据存储优化 除去数据库的设计,在数据存储方面也有一些优化办法可以提升网站的性能和数据访问速度。冗余数据的处置:防止在数据库中存储很多重复或无效的数据。对于冗余数据,可以通过拆分表、打造关联等办法进行处置,以降低数据冗余。合理分区:对于大型网站或拥有大量数据的网站,可以将数据库根据特定的规则进行分区存储。分区可以参考时间、地点等规则进行,以便提升数据的读写速度。读写离别:将数据库的读操作和写操作分开,用不一样的数据库服务器进行处置。读写离别可以提升网站的访问速度和并发能力。缓存数据:将常见的数据缓存在内存中,降低对数据库的访问次数。用缓存可以显著提升网站的响应速度。3. 数据库安全 在网站制作中,数据库的安全性尤为重要。以下是一些保障数据库安全的建议:权限控制:对数据库的用户和角色进行适合的权限控制,禁止未授权的职员对数据进行操作。数据加密:对敏锐数据进行加密存储,加大数据的安全性。可以用对称加密、非对称加密等加密算法。按期备份:按期备份数据库,以防数据丢失或意料之外损毁。备份数据可以存储在不同地方,以预防单点问题。用防火墙和安全软件:通过用防火墙和安全软件,可以预防未经授权的访问和恶意攻击。在网站制作中,数据库设计和数据存储优化是关乎整个网站性能和客户体验的要紧环节。通过合理设计数据库结构,优化数据存储方法,与加大数据库的安全性,可以提升网站的性能、稳定性和安全性。建议网站建设职员在进行数据库设计时,要依据实质需要和数据特征进行灵活调整,以获得最好的数据库用成效。